Q: Is 3,186,882 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,186,882 is a composite number.

Why is 3,186,882 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,186,882 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 18 47 94 141 282 423 846 3,767 7,534 11,301 22,602 33,903 67,806 177,049 354,098 531,147 1,062,294 1,593,441 and 3,186,882, with no remainder.

Since 3,186,882 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,186,882, it is a composite number.
